WebThe notationsRez andImz stand forthe realandimaginarypartsofthe complexnumber z, respectively. If z = x +iy (with x and y real) they are defined by Rez = x Imz = y Note that both Rez and Imz are real numbers. WebFor a real number, we can write z = a+0i = a for some real number a. So the complex conjugate z∗ = a − 0i = a, which is also equal to z. So a real number is its own complex conjugate. WebIn polar form, complex numbers are represented as the combination of the modulus r and argument θ of the complex number. The polar form of a complex number z = x + iy with coordinates (x, y) is given as z = r cosθ + i r sinθ = r (cosθ + i sinθ).
